[โ€“] blinfabian@feddit.nl 14 points 2 months ago

Brave๐Ÿ‡บ๐Ÿ‡ธ -> Vivaldi๐Ÿ‡ณ๐Ÿ‡ด, Qwant๐Ÿ‡ซ๐Ÿ‡ท, Ecosia๐Ÿ‡ฉ๐Ÿ‡ช, Mojeek๐Ÿ‡ฌ๐Ÿ‡ง, Waterfox๐ŸŒ

Tiktok๐Ÿ‡จ๐Ÿ‡ณ -> Loops.video๐ŸŒ

Kagi Translate๐Ÿ‡บ๐Ÿ‡ธ -> DeepL๐Ÿ‡ฉ๐Ÿ‡ช (but from my experience kagi is wayy better)
